The invention discloses an explosion experimental device for simulating an underground free field environment. The device comprises a spherical pressure container, an inner wall sprayed layer, an operation sealing head, a detonation line interface, a pressure sensor test interface, an explosive fixing rod, a fixing groove, a water inlet, a water outlet, an installation base, a flange plate, toughened glass and a base support. The explosion experimental device has the beneficial effects that the spherical pressure container is used as a main body, meeting the requirement of certain amount of explosive for many experiments; the device can be pressurized so as to simulate a certain deep water environment; a spherical tank is provided with an observation window which allows an operator to observe shapes of bubbles in the tank in experiment; the interior of the tank is treated by spraying or pasting multiple layers of material better in wave impedance matching, so as to absorb or suppress reflected impulse load to realize an underground free field environment.
